Received an email to set up a phone screen (approx. 3 weeks after applying online). The recruiter was slow in responding to my email indicating my availability.
On the phone call, she launched right into questions and didn't talk about the role at all. She just seemed very disinterested in the whole process, and I felt like just another box to check. Salary was the second question she asked (about 2 minutes into the call). When I deferred answering, she got slightly antagonistic and implied I could not proceed with the process if I did not provide a target salary.
As a result, I asked some detailed questions about the position, which turned out to be a much more junior role than I thought. I'm glad she was straightforward, but then I asked about the cultural/employee engagement impact due to recent organizational restructuring. She never provided a straight answer, which was a BIG RED FLAG that things are not going well at the company. She then pressured me again to name a target salary.
I decided to withdraw from consideration, as the role wasn't what was in the job description and because if a company's front line (talent acquisition) can't even give me reasons to work there (culture), then why should I?
